Health Club Management: State of the Fitness Industry Report 2022 finds UK Industry Building Back to Pre-pandemic Levels
Posted: Thu, 09 Jun 2022 14:27
The State of the Fitness Industry Report for 2022 shows that 631 clubs have closed, with majority early in the pandemic, while 455 have opened - a difference of 176. Market value is down by 4.3% and membership has dropped by 4.7%.

Sustrans: eBike Charging Stations on the National Cycle Network
Posted: Thu, 26 May 2022 14:58
Sustrans has partnered with Bosch eBike Systems to introduce electric bike charging stations on National Cycle Network routes across the UK. The charging stations will give eBike riders the confidence to take long distance strips across the British countryside.
Sustrans: Ban on Pavement Parking would Encourage more People to Walk and Wheel
Posted: Thu, 26 May 2022 14:22
Sustran's Walking and Cycling Index has found that banning pavement parking would help 70% of all residents to walk or wheel more.
